Compare Port Charlotte to Lauderdale Lakes

This post compares Port Charlotte, Florida to Lauderdale Lakes, Florida across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Port Charlotte (CDP) Lauderdale Lakes (city)
Population 59,654 34,744
Income (median) $33,552 $28,087
Home Value (median) $137,800 $101,600
White 85% 11%
Black 9% 84%
Asian 1% 1%
With Kids 19% 35%
Age (median) 52 35
Rentals 25% 45%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Port Charlotte or Lauderdale Lakes?
A: Port Charlotte has a larger population count than Lauderdale Lakes: 59654 compared with 34744 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Port Charlotte or in Lauderdale Lakes?
A: Incomes are on average higher in Port Charlotte.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Port Charlotte or Lauderdale Lakes?
A: Homes tend to be more expensive in Port Charlotte.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Lauderdale Lakes does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 25% for Port Charlotte versus 45% for Lauderdale Lakes.
